> It is the usual undefined main() issue is my guess.
>
> configure:14679: checking for compatible POSIX regex
> configure:14714: cc -o conftest -g -O2 -I/opt/sw/include/db5 =
> -DBIND_8_COMPAT -I/opt/sw/include -Wl,-dead_strip_dylibs =
> -Wl,-headerpad_max_install_names conftest.c -lkrb5 -L/opt/sw/lib =
> -ldb-5.3 >&5
> conftest.c:84:1: error: type specifier missing, defaults to 'int'; ISO =
> C99 and later do not support implicit int [-Wimplicit-int]
>    84 | main()
>       | ^
>       | int
> 1 error generated.
> configure:14714: $? =3D 1
> configure: program exited with status 1
